Innsbruck is the "Capital of the Alps," a historic Tyrolean city where imperial heritage meets world-class skiing. The Golden Roof, baroque palaces, and colorful medieval old town sit beneath 2,000-meter peaks, offering both cultural richness and outdoor adventure.

Salzburg is a baroque masterpiece nestled in the Austrian Alps—birthplace of Mozart and setting for The Sound of Music. This picturesque city offers stunning architecture, classical music heritage, and easy access to alpine scenery.

Steingasse
A narrow, medieval lane on the right bank of the Salzach, once home to salt traders and boatmen, now lined with quirky bars, art galleries, and boutique hotels.
